Comprehending Corporation Filing Costs

When starting a corporate entity, understanding the expenses associated with corporation filing is important for effective economic management. Each jurisdiction has its own fees, which can change greatly based on factors such as the category of company being established and the services required. Fundamental filing charges for incorporation documents or company registration generally range from fifty to numerous hundreds USD. Additionally, there may be extra costs related to obtaining necessary licenses and permits, depending on the character of the enterprise.

In addition to the initial filing charges, corporations may encounter recurring costs, such as periodic registration fees or franchise taxes, that are necessary to ensure favorable status with local authorities. These ongoing costs are important for maintaining corporate records current and guaranteeing compliance with local regulations. Not satisfy these requirements can lead to penalties, which can amplify overall expenses significantly.

Procedural Corporate Registration Procedure

The corporate filing process starts by deciding the appropriate type of company you want to establish, whether it be a C Corp, S Company, or Professional Corporation. Each type has its individual criteria and advantages. Once you have decided on the kind, the following step is to choose a title for your corporation. It is essential to make sure that the chosen title adheres with regional laws and is never previously in utilized. Additionally, you should verify if the name is open for trademark protection to protect your trademark.

After selecting a title, you will have to create and submit the needed formation papers, which typically entail Incorporation Documents or Certificate of Formation. These papers may need particular details such as the company's title, mission, agent of record, and information about the shares you'll be offering. Depending on your location, you may need submit these papers through the internet or by mail, along with the required filing charges. Utilizing a business filing service can streamline this process and make sure that all documents are completed correctly.

Once your formation papers are accepted, you will receive a confirmation from the state, marking the formal establishment of your company. After  construction contractors directory , it is important to comply with ongoing filing obligations, such as yearly reports and modifications in corporate organization. Maintaining corporate records organized and updated is vital for ensuring adherence and protecting your business. Regularly monitoring your corporation's filing status and deadlines can assist avoid penalties and promote smooth functioning.

Frequent Corporation Submission Pitfalls to Watch Out For

One of the key common mistakes made during the company filing method is failing to completely grasp the required documents. Each jurisdiction has specific criteria for business creation and business viability. Failing to provide the right forms or omitting crucial information can lead to delays or even denial of your submission. Always review your selected state's regulations and ensure all required documents is correctly filled out.

Another common mistake involves missing deadlines for submission. Each corporation must comply with strict schedules for initial registrations, periodic re-registrations, and other compliance documents. Missing these timelines could lead to penalties, dissolution of the business, or deprivation of good standing. It is crucial to create reminders and maintain a schedule specifically for these important events to prevent any problems.

Lastly, many organizations overlook the importance of correctness in the information submitted during the filing procedure. Errors or inaccurate information can lead to major problems, including legal consequences down the line. Verify all entries for correctness and contemplate having a professional check the forms before submission to ensure that all details corresponds with regulatory requirements. This care to detail will help protect your company from potential complications.
